Within a new analyze, we noted the identification as well as characterization of a fresh atypical opioid receptor with one of a kind destructive regulatory properties toward opioid peptides.one Our success showed that ACKR3/CXCR7, hitherto often known as an atypical scavenger receptor for chemokines CXCL12 and CXCL11, is also a wide-spectrum scavenger for opioid peptides in the enkephalin, dynorphin, and nociceptin family members, regulating their availability for classical opioid receptors.

We demonstrated that, in contrast to classical opioid receptors, ACKR3 won't cause classical G protein signaling and isn't modulated through the classical prescription or analgesic opioids, like morphine, fentanyl, or buprenorphine, or by nonselective opioid antagonists which include naloxone. Instead, we proven that LIH383, an ACKR3-selective subnanomolar competitor peptide, prevents ACKR3’s negative regulatory functionality on opioid peptides in an ex vivo rat brain model and potentiates their action towards classical opioid receptors.

The atypical chemokine receptor ACKR3 has a short while ago been described to work as an opioid scavenger with special unfavorable regulatory Attributes to various families of opioid peptides.
This receptor also binds to opioid peptides, but as an alternative to bringing about ache reduction, it traps the peptides and helps prevent them from binding to any of your traditional receptors, thus perhaps blocking agony modulation.
Researchers think that blocking this scavenger receptor implies that it may not avoid Obviously generated opioids from interacting with other opioid receptors that advertise soreness aid.
